Check Out the Different Kinds Of Roof Covering Materials and Their Unique Benefits Selecting the ideal roofing material is crucial for both the defense and visual appeal of a home. Each product brings distinct advantages, such as the durability of steel or the environmentally friendly attributes of wood shakes. The https://danteagaup.blogs-service.com/64760139/trusted-roofing-contractor-for-premium-quality-roofing-materials